Output 969975505e63aae620e14219363835852d13cd383566183fbb9f9798fda3d73e:2

value
767064
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 19f83ed74a74b1a6e4b80740e3aa0bf61967b60d6a8ed9e9dccaf27a1b6b4196
address
tb1pr8ura462wjc6de9cqaqw82st7cvk0dsdd28dn6wuete85xmtgxtq0jvuye
transaction
969975505e63aae620e14219363835852d13cd383566183fbb9f9798fda3d73e
confirmations
51410
spent
true